Putting this out here to help anyone who has problems with this particular error.
The form to submit an enquiry kept failing with this error message. I eventually through trial and error found that the problem is if you click the radio button saying you know the contents of your package, but then don't click any of the checkbox options for package contents because none apply, the form fails.
Checking Unknown in the long list of options for the package contents allowed the form to be submitted.

Goto USPS.com and login. After you are logged into the site, visit this URL directly: https://missingmail.usps.com/#/
Using this method, I can get it to load every single time. When you click the link from the "missing mail and lost packages" page, the URL gets encoded with some sort of tracking tag which is what is causing the page to not load properly (potentially). When you use the link I provided, it bypasses that aspect. Definitely let me know if this works for you. Good luck.
EDIT: For those having issues. Do it on a computer browser, not a mobile/phone browser and this should still work.
EDIT 2: Since many of you don't want to spend time reading comments, and the 2nd method has been downvoted enough to be far down the page...
Alternatively, if this doesn't work, here is another method. You still must be logged in, then visit this link: https://missingmail.usps.com/#/history
Once on this page, click on the link that reads "New Search Request". This also works for me and is how I discovered the first method.
